– Carry out one or several of the following steps:
– To enable a marker select the required marker by checking the
relevant control box in the Marker area (A1 to A10 or B1 to
B10). To enable a delta marker check the relevant control box in
the Delta Marker area (DA2 to DA10 or DB2 to DB10).
– To put a marker on the maximum peak click on
Max Peak.
– To put a marker on the next peak click on
Next Peak.
– To put a marker on all peaks (up to the 10 supported markers)
click on
Label All Peaks.
– To set a threshold for the Label All Peaks function click on
Set
Threshold
. The button label changes to Clear Threshold.
Specify your threshold in the field below by clicking on the up
and down arrows. the threshold will be displayed as a read line.
If you want to remove the limit, click on
Clear Threshold. After
specifying the threshold only peaks above the threshold will be
labeled.
– To enter descriptions for the markers click on Marker Descrip-
tion. A Marker Description window is displayed. Enter the
descriptions for the markers set and click on
OK. Deselect the
text in the Show in Trace box on the right-hand side if you do not
want the text to appear in the graph.
The descriptions will be displayed in the graph with a line
connecting the text with the appropriate marker position.
